""Notes On South African Hunting, And Notes On A Ride To The Victoria Falls Of The Zambesi"" is a travelogue written by Alfred J. Bethell in 1887. The book describes the author’s experiences during his hunting trips in South Africa and his journey to the Victoria Falls of the Zambesi River. Bethell shares his observations on the flora, fauna, and people he encountered during his travels, as well as his impressions of the landscape and the culture of the region. The book is a fascinating glimpse into the colonial era of Africa and provides insight into the attitudes of Europeans towards the continent and its inhabitants at the time.
